Net Margin shows how much profit a company keeps from each dollar of sales after all expenses, including taxes and interest. It reflects the company`s overall profitability.

Glance View
BMW Industries Ltd., a name echoing through the corridors of the manufacturing sector, operates at the confluence of innovation and industrial prowess. Emerging as a formidable player in the landscape of steel processing and engineering products, BMW Industries has carved a niche that capitalizes on its diverse portfolio. With its roots deep in the grassy terrains of metallurgy, the company specializes in steel processing, primarily catering to the needs of the infrastructure, automobile, and engineering sectors. The revenue engine revs through its production of a wide array of steel products, including tubes, pipes, and hollow sections, each crafted meticulously to meet the stringent demands of its clientele. Underpinned by a robust supply chain network, the company ensures that its industrial outputs are seamlessly transported and integrated into its customers' projects, ranging from high-rise constructions to modern road networks. Net Margin is calculated by dividing the Net Income by the Revenue.
The current Net Margin for BMW Industries Ltd is 10.7%, which is below its 3-year median of 11.1%.
Over the last 3 years, BMW Industries Ltd’s Net Margin has increased from 8% to 10.7%. During this period, it reached a low of 8% on Dec 1, 2022 and a high of 12.6% on Dec 31, 2024.
